TENNIS

Aggies sweep Big 12 honors: Texas A&M's Elzé Potgieter and Conor Pollock were named the Big 12 tennis players of the week on Monday.

Potgieter, a junior with the Aggie women, won the conference honor for the first time. Pollock, a senior All-American, is also a first-time winner.

GOLF

Johnson hot in Hawaii: HONOLULU -- Senior Lauren Johnson fired a 1-under 71 on Monday to lead Texas A&M into a tie for fifth place after the opening round of the Thompson Invitational at Kanehoe Klipper Golf Course.

The Aggies posted a team score of 306 and trail leader Idaho by nine strokes going into Tuesday's second round. Nevada and Osaka Gakuin are tied for second at 303, followed by Kansas State (305). A&M is tied with Hawaii and Boise State.

Johnson is tied for second in the individual standings, two shots behind Idaho's Kayla Mortellaro. A&M sophomore Sarah Zwartynski is tied for seventh at 74. A&M's other scores were Ashley Freeman (80), Stephanie Smith (81) and Kaitlin Hovda (82).
